WINTER-SEASON WATER DETAILS:
The cold temperatures during the winter require the water to be turned on upon arrival and turned off upon departure.
This is accomplished with a quick turn of a floor-mounted handled underneath the kitchen dining booth. It takes just a quarter turn of the handle. When the water is on you will hear the pipes activate and water will begin immediately flowing from the faucets.
HEATING :
The thermostat is mounted on the short stairwell wall adjacent to the TV. This controls the gas floor furnace in the entry. Please make yourself comfortable and thank you for turning the heat down when outside enjoying the beautiful surroundings. It's very helpful to simultaneously turn on the ceiling fan. The heat (that has a tendency to rise up into the loft) is pulled down and better circulates in the downstairs area. The control knob for the fan is next to the wall-mounted coat rack.
Additionally, there are two heater fans that also pull down and circulate heat into the downstairs bedroom and kitchen. One knob is on the wall to the right side of the refrigerator. One knob is on the wall to the right side of the washer/dryer closet.
During Winter it's also helpful to keep the bathroom door closed and keep the bedroom door open for circulation benefits.
Please ignore BOTH the thermostat in the downstairs bedroom by the small, iron coat rack AND the small wall-mounted heater below the bedroom window. These have been deactivated for safety reasons.
If the wood burning stove is used please DO NOT clean out hot ashes. Housekeeping will handle.
VERY IMPORTANT....DO NOT LEAVE ANY CLOTHING, FOOTWEAR OR TOWELS NEARTHE FLOOR FURNACE. IF SOMETHING FALLS AND IS UNATTENDED A FIRE IS A SURE BET. PLEASE ALSO KEEP LITTLE BARE FEET AWAY FROM THE FLOOR FURNACE GRILL :)
OTHER STUFF
Backing into the driveway is easier and safer when exiting. A private plow service routinely and automatically services the driveway. The County maintains neighborhood streets.
The snow shovel can be used for any small berms needing removal. A small canister of "ice melt" is also available and can be sprinkled by hand like birdseed on the front door path if snow is anticipated or snow is actually coming down to help with slipping or sliding.

WINTER:
Cross-Country, Hiking, Snow Shoeing Trails and Sledding Hill...
There is a great hiking/snow shoe trail you can get to without a car.
Go out the front door and turn right when at the top of the driveway. Go right at the first street. It's called Pino. This street dead ends in an approximate length equaling a city block or two. You'll see a small frozen creek. On the other side of this creek you'll see a trail that goes back up into the mountain. Very nice trail only used by locals.
There is also a formal trail at the North Tahoe Regional Park. This too is very close but requires a short car drive. Here you can find hiking trails and a fun sledding hill.
Go back out on to the main lake road.
Go right at the lake.
Take the second right on to National Ave.
At the end of this road you'll see the park entrance.
